Bridging the Gap: Smart Payment Integration for Legacy Machines
Wiki Article
Many manufacturers grapple with the challenge of modernizing a payment workflows on legacy machinery. These units, often crucial to ongoing operations, weren't originally designed to support the complex payment options required by today's customers. However, abandoning these valuable assets isn’t always practical. Instead, a strategic approach involving smart payment integration can offer a effective pathway. This might involve utilizing adapters or custom-built applications that translate modern payment protocols into a format understandable by the present hardware. Such an approach not only safeguards assets but also opens alternative revenue streams by enabling automated payment processing directly at the point of service. Remote Equipment Monitoring: Ensuring Peak Performance & Uptime
Maintaining optimal equipment functionality is paramount for industrial continuity, and increasingly, remote equipment monitoring offers a viable solution. This approach allows for the real-time assessment of vital parameters – from levels and vibration to force and amperage – without the need for frequent on-site assessments. By proactively identifying emerging issues, businesses can reduce unexpected downtime, maximize maintenance schedules, and ultimately secure maximum uptime, directly impacting profitability and user satisfaction. The data gathered can also be used to adjust equipment function and increase its longevity.
